Compared to the vast and magnificent Songnfjord, Norway's largest fjord, Hardangerfjord is very gentle and is known for its pastoral scenery - Norway's orchard. Its beauty lies not only in the fjord, but also in valleys, waterfalls, glaciers... Our tour group departed from the town of Worth, passing the Hardan Earl Bridge across the fjord, and enjoying the scenery of Hardan Earl Fjord and the two major waterfalls of Voringfoss.

Hardanger is the gentlest of the four major fjords in Norway. The lake is calm like a mirror, the villages are scattered and the pastoral scenery is lingering. It is also the most famous fruit planting place in Norway, and the waterfalls and glaciers here are also very famous, attracting thousands of tourists to visit.
